如何在.NET应用程序中维护树视图控件的滚动位置?例如,我有一个树视图控件,并通过添加各种节点的过程将它们固定到底部.在此过程中,我可以滚动树视图并查看不同的节点.问题是当进程完成时,树视图滚动到最底部.
似乎调用treenode.Expand()是让我偏离轨道的原因.展开父节点时,它将获得焦点.
有没有解决的办法?如果我在进程运行时查看特定节点,我不希望它在进程完成时跳转到我身边.
.net treeview winforms
.net ×1
treeview ×1
winforms ×1